s/_/-/ in PEAR/PECL -> rpm name?

Though it isn't mentioned explicitly here, it would appear that the PEAR package name has all of the underscores replaced with dashes in the rpm package name.... or am I missing something here? Chris Weyl 07:53, 13 August 2008 (UTC)

Some package use the underscore Most package use the dash This has been discussed on fedora-devel, this is a packager choice. Remi Collet Mon Jan 3 18:47:52 CET 2011

No, no longer fedora-newrpmspec but rpmdev-newspec Kiilerix 09:59, 14 October 2009 (UTC)

But, the simplest way is (which follow as much as possible this Guidelines)

yum install php-pear-PEAR-Command-Packaging
pear make-rpm-spec Foo.tgz
